Managing Your Sales Funnel



what is a sales funnel

A sales funnel can help you increase sales and boost your marketing efforts. You can also improve your marketing by managing your sales funnel. This article will explain the stages of a sale funnel and how you can measure success.

A sales funnel

Creating a sales funnel is a critical step in the process of digital marketing. It shows the customer's journey from discovery to purchase. It is useful for sales reps to understand how their leads make purchasing decisions. This will help them improve their sales strategies. It can also assist marketers in creating relevant messaging.

Knowing your audience is the first step to creating a sales funnel. Your audience will have a unique customer experience. Knowing their needs and preferences can help you to create a sales funnel that meets their needs and interests.

Next, identify your pain points. Your company will need to offer valuable content and guidance. This will help you to attract prospects and convince them that your offer is the best one for them.

Next, you need to create buyer persons. Buyer personas represent profiles of the ideal customer. These personas are created through research and long term engagement with the target audience. It is possible to create buyer personas to better understand potential customers and help them to purchase your products.

Next, create a sales funnel to convert your audience into customers. This is vital because it will help you build loyalty as well as scale. Customers can receive special rewards, coupons codes and other benefits. This is because it's more cost-effective to keep customers than to find new ones.

Not every lead will become a customer. There are many metrics that can be used to track your success. These include conversion rates as well as prospect to opportunity and lead to prospect ratios. To track your sales metrics, you can use tools such as Google Analytics.

A sales funnel is not easy to set up. It is a complex process that requires a lot of trial and error. You must also ensure that you have a clear purpose for each step. You must also use the right tools to track your success rates.

Stages of a sales funnel

A sales funnel is a great way of ensuring that the right message is delivered at the right moment. The sales funnel describes the steps that a customer takes during the buying process. These steps can be broken into different stages and may vary depending on what type of business you are in, your niche, or prospect. Each stage requires a different approach by the marketer.

Awareness is when potential customers first hear about a company and its products. This can be through social media, advertising, or word of mouth. Customers can also do research online about the company. They will evaluate brands, evaluate features and benefits, and compare prices.

The interest stage occurs when customers are researching the business and are comparing prices, features, and packaging options. They might also be considering multiple solutions. They will look at pricing, then choose the one that best fits their needs. The sales funnel will then take them to consideration. The salesperson assists the prospect in deciding which product or service would be the best fit. Customer testimonials are also great at the consideration stage.

This is an excellent time to present product demos, expert guides and training videos. Your proposal should highlight the benefits of your product/service. They should also address the biggest pain points your prospect has.

The decision stage indicates that a prospect has made a decision to purchase. They may still have questions or be uncertain about their decision to buy. They might also have an idea of what they want. They might want to talk with a salesperson about pricing, features, and even request a demo. They will then evaluate other factors, such as pricing, features, and packaging, before making a purchase.

The action stage is the final stage of the sales funnel. This is the most challenging part of the sales funnel, but it is also one of the most important. This is the last stage at which a prospect will purchase. It is also where the salesperson can have the most impact. The most important step is to ensure that the prospect is satisfied, and that they become a brand advocate.

Measuring the results

Using metrics to measure the results of your sales funnel can give you actionable insights and show you how your marketing efforts are performing. These metrics will help you to make better forecasts and help you adjust your marketing strategy. It is crucial to ensure that your metrics are tailored to your business. You can monitor key metrics regularly to determine if you are reaching your objectives.

Conversion rate is a common metric that will help you assess the performance of your sales funnel. Conversion rate is the number of leads that convert into paying customers. A high conversion rate means you've successfully converted people. A low conversion rate could be a sign that your sales funnel is not working.

A length of your sale cycle is another indicator that will help you determine the effectiveness and efficiency of your sales funnel. The average time a prospect spends in the sales funnel before becoming buyers is called the length of your sales process. You can get this information by measuring the time that people spend entering their details and then taking steps.

You can also use the average order value to measure how well your sales funnel is performing. The average order value is the revenue generated from an order. You can use the following formula to calculate the average order value: Track the total revenue generated by sales, and divide it with the number of orders.

Other key metrics to be tracked include total leads produced, qualified leads, as well as the average time it takes leads to convert into paying customers. Qualified lead is someone who is interested in your products. This metric can be measured by counting the number of qualified leads who convert into paying customers.

This will help you to see where there is potential for improvement. This can then lead you to focus on those areas for improvement. To increase customer acquisition, your product pricing can be modified.

How can I create a SEO strategy?

An effective SEO strategy starts with understanding your goals and how to get there. This allows you to structure your content around these goals.

The second step is to start working on your keywords. Through keyword research, you can get insight into what people want to find by using certain words. You can then write articles about those topics by using this information.

After writing your articles ensure that you include your target keywords in them. You should also make sure to optimize each article with relevant images or videos. Last, be sure to include links to related pages wherever you can.

After you have completed all of the content on your site, it is time to optimize that content!
